Understanding Integers
Before diving into multiplication and division, it’s important to understand what integers are. Integers are whole numbers that can be positive, negative, or zero. For instance:
- Positive integers: 1, 2, 3, ...
- Negative integers: -1, -2, -3, ...
- Zero: 0
Integers do not include fractions or decimals. This characteristic makes them uniquely suited for various mathematical operations, including multiplication and division.

Sample Worksheet
Below is a sample worksheet that can be used for practicing multiplication and division of integers. Teachers can customize it according to their students' levels.
Multiplying and Dividing Integers Worksheet
Part A: Multiply the following integers.
1. 3 x 4 = ______
2. -5 x -6 = ______
3. 7 x -2 = ______
4. -8 x 3 = ______
Part B: Divide the following integers.
1. 18 ÷ 3 = ______
2. -24 ÷ 6 = ______
3. -35 ÷ -5 = ______
4. 0 ÷ 5 = ______
Part C: Mixed Operations
1. 9 x -4 + 12 = ______
2. -12 ÷ 3 - 5 = ______
3. 6 x 2 ÷ -3 = ______
4. -18 ÷ 2 x 3 = ______
Part D: Word Problems
1. A temperature dropped from 10°C to -5°C. What was the change in temperature? (Hint: Use subtraction)
2. A car travels at a speed of 60 km/h. How far will it travel in 4 hours? (Multiplication)
Answers to the Worksheet
Providing answers is essential for self-assessment. Below are the answers for the sample worksheet:
Part A: Multiply the following integers.
1. 3 x 4 = 12
2. -5 x -6 = 30
3. 7 x -2 = -14
4. -8 x 3 = -24
Part B: Divide the following integers.
1. 18 ÷ 3 = 6
2. -24 ÷ 6 = -4
3. -35 ÷ -5 = 7
4. 0 ÷ 5 = 0
Part C: Mixed Operations
1. 9 x -4 + 12 = -36 + 12 = -24
2. -12 ÷ 3 - 5 = -4 - 5 = -9
3. 6 x 2 ÷ -3 = 12 ÷ -3 = -4
4. -18 ÷ 2 x 3 = -9 x 3 = -27
Part D: Word Problems
1. The change in temperature = 10 - (-5) = 15°C
2. Distance = Speed x Time = 60 km/h x 4 h = 240 km

What are the basic rules for multiplying integers in a worksheet?
When multiplying integers, if both integers have the same sign (both positive or both negative), the product is positive. If the integers have different signs, the product is negative.
How do you set up a dividing integers worksheet?
To set up a dividing integers worksheet, create a list of problems that include pairs of integers to divide. Ensure to include a mix of positive and negative integers to practice the rules of division.
What is the answer for -8 ÷ 4?
-8 ÷ 4 equals -2, because dividing a negative integer by a positive integer results in a negative quotient.
Can you give an example of a multiplying integers problem from a worksheet?
Sure! An example problem is: 7 × -3. The answer is -21, since a positive times a negative yields a negative product.
